Education: Graduation from an accredited high school or possession of a high school equivalency certificate.
Experience: Six years of administrative staff or professional work.
Notes:
1. Candidates may substitute 30 college credit hours from an accredited college or university for each year up to four years of the required experience.
2. Candidates may substitute the possession of a Bachelors degree from an accredited college or university and two years of experience in administrative staff or professional work for the required experience.
3. Candidates may substitute the possession of a Masters degree from an accredited college or university for the required experience.
4. Candidates may substitute U.S. Armed Forces military service experience as a commissioned officer involving staff work related to the administration of rules regulations policy procedures and processes or overseeing or coordinating unit operations or functioning as a staff assistant to a higher ranking commissioned officer on a year-for-year basis for the required experience.
Three or more yearsexperience within the Analytical and Technical Unit responding to subpoenasMPIA fulfilment and providing courtroom testimony
Proficient with thefollowing Systems/Software Programs: (1) Security Threat Group (STG)identification validations and the entry of STG data (2) ViaPath (GTL)telecommunication systems (3) Navigation and data entry of Offender CaseManagement System (OCMS) (4) Automated Gang Intel Information System (AGI)and (5) external and internal IID systems and databases

Personal Leave - new State employees are awardedsix (6) personnel days annually (prorated based on start date)
Annual Leave - ten (10) days of accumulatedannual leave per year
Sick Leave - fifteen (15) daysof accumulated sick leave per year
Parental Leave - up to sixty(60) days of paid parental leave upon the birth or adoption of a child
Holidays - State employees alsocelebrate at least twelve (12) holidays per year
Pension - State employees earn credit towardsa retirement pension
